The story was first circulated via the highly heated satirical Facebook group “America’s Last Line of Defense.” Although some social media users thought.
The message was accurate, others drew attention to the fact that the page often posts inflated or inaccurate statements in an attempt to increase interaction.
There are no indications of any intentions to bring back the Aunt Jemima trademark on Quaker Oats’ official website or social media accounts.
Furthermore, no such development has been reported by major news sites. Customers’ opinions of the rebranding to Pearl Milling Company were divided;
Some were in favor of it, while others were nostalgic for the old name. Quaker Oats, however, insisted that the action was a step in the direction of greater inclusion.
As of right now, the notion that Aunt Jemima will return seems to be just that—a rumor. Before publishing anything on social media, people are advised to confirm it with reliable sources.
